CDN的瞬间,如何实现互联网内容的快速分发?

内容分发网络(CDN)通过在多个地理位置部署服务器,缓存网站内容,实现快速响应用户请求,提高网站的加载速度和可用性。CDN能有效减轻源服务器的负担,优化用户体验,并提升网站的整体性能。

CDN(Content Delivery Network,内容分发网络)是现代互联网中不可或缺的一项技术,它通过智能分配和缓存机制,优化了数据的传输路径,加快了内容的加载速度,CDN的瞬间,即是从用户请求到获取内容的短暂过程中,CDN如何发挥其重要作用,以下是对这一过程的详细解析:

cdn的瞬间
(图片来源网络,侵删)

1、CDN的概念与功能

定义:CDN是一种构建在现有网络基础之上的智能虚拟网络,通过部署在不同地理位置的边缘服务器来实现其功能。

主要功能:CDN的核心功能是在多个地点缓存内容,并通过负载均衡技术将用户的请求定向到最合适的缓存服务器上。

2、CDN的工作原理

缓存机制:CDN加速的本质在于缓存加速,即静态内容被存储在靠近用户的CDN节点上,这样当内容被请求时,可以直接从最近的节点获取,而不必每次都回到源服务器。

智能调度:CDN通过网络负载情况和用户地理位置,智能地将用户的请求指向响应速度最快的节点。

3、CDN的技术组件

cdn的瞬间
(图片来源网络,侵删)

边缘节点:也称为CDN节点或Cache节点,是距离最终用户较近,具有较少中间环节的网络节点,对最终用户体验有直接影响。

中心平台:负责整体的负载均衡、内容管理以及节点分配的逻辑控制。

4、CDN的应用效果

提高访问速度:由于物理距离的缩短和智能路由选择,用户能够更快地访问到所需内容。

减轻服务器负担:源服务器不需要直接处理所有请求,从而减轻了负载压力。

5、CDN的优化策略

分发:除了静态内容外,CDN还可以优化动态内容的分发,如实时视频直播、互动性强的在线服务等。

cdn的瞬间
(图片来源网络,侵删)

安全性增强:CDN能够提供额外的安全层,如防止分布式拒绝服务(DDoS)攻击,保护源站不受直接冲击。

6、CDN的未来趋势

智能化发展:随着人工智能和机器学习技术的发展,CDN的调度和优化策略将更加智能化,更精准地响应用户需求。

全球覆盖扩展:为了满足全球化的服务需求,CDN节点的布局将持续扩大,实现更广泛的地域覆盖。

CDN作为互联网基础设施的重要组成部分,通过其独特的缓存和智能调度机制,极大地优化了数据传递路径,提升了用户体验,随着技术的不断进步和用户需求的不断增长,CDN将持续演进,以更高效、更安全、更智能的方式服务于全球用户的快速内容访问需求。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/854814.html

(0)
未希的头像未希新媒体运营
上一篇 2024-08-09 13:37
下一篇 2024-08-09 13:39

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入